Resident Notice - City of Katy Water System

Aug 8, 2022

Dear residents, it has come to our attention the City of Katy has elevated to and implemented Stage 2 of their Drought Contingency Plan, making it mandatory to restrict water usage. This notification applies only to residents and businesses who receive water from the City of Katy infrastructure.

As residents of Willow Point Municipal Utility District, rest assured you do not receive water from the City of Katy, so this information can be misleading when shared on local social media groups. Each Municipal Utility District has its own water treatment infrastructure and is responsible for setting its own restrictions. While we are residents of the Katy area, we are on our own system and do not rely on the City of Katy’s infrastructure for water use and consumption.

At this time, our District has set the level to Stage 1, Voluntary Restrictions, and thank those residents who are making efforts to reduce unnecessary water consumption or waste. Likewise, we continue to recommend setting irrigation systems to water in the nighttime hours for the greatest efficiency and the least amount of water evaporation.
